Salta al contenuto

Roadmap Certificazioni Database 2026

Dalle basi SQL a competenze reali sui database

I database sono dietro quasi ogni prodotto digitale serio: siti web, applicazioni, analytics, cloud, sistemi aziendali e AI. Questa roadmap ti guida in un percorso realistico: prima SQL, poi relazionale, poi amministrazione e performance, infine NoSQL quando le basi sono solide.

0

Step 0

� Livello 0 — Fondamenti SQL

FREEBeginner

Parti dalla base universale: SELECT, WHERE, ORDER BY, JOIN, GROUP BY, subquery, vincoli, indici e normalizzazione base. Prima di pensare a strumenti avanzati, devi capire come i dati vengono salvati, collegati e interrogati.

Recommended certification

MySQL

Recommended certification

SQL pratico

Obiettivo: Scrivere query SQL con sicurezza e capire le relazioni tra tabelle.

Reality check

Molti principianti sottovalutano SQL perché sembra semplice all’inizio. In realtà, basi SQL deboli ti bloccheranno più avanti in backend, analytics, cloud e amministrazione database.

Common mistakes

  • Memorizzare sintassi senza fare query reali
  • Saltare JOIN e relazioni tra tabelle
  • Ignorare normalizzazione e consistenza dei dati
  • Passare subito a NoSQL senza capire il relazionale

What you can realistically achieve

  • Scrivere query SQL base e intermedie
  • Comprendere tabelle, chiavi e relazioni
  • Costruire basi solide per backend, data e cloud
1

Step 1

� Livello 1 — Database relazionali

PREMIUMBeginner

Quando le basi SQL sono solide, scegli un ecosistema relazionale. MySQL è pratico e diffusissimo, SQL Server è forte negli ambienti Microsoft/enterprise, Oracle domina ancora molti contesti enterprise tradizionali.

Recommended certification

MySQL

Recommended certification

Microsoft SQL Server

Recommended certification

Oracle Database SQL

Obiettivo: Capire transazioni, lock, execution plan e basi di performance.

Reality check

A questo livello la sfida non è più solo scrivere query. Devi capire come si comportano i database con utenti reali, dati reali e logiche business vere.

Common mistakes

  • Pensare che tutti i database funzionino allo stesso modo
  • Ignorare transazioni e consistenza
  • Scrivere query senza ragionare sulle performance
  • Scegliere un database solo perché è popolare

What you can realistically achieve

  • Comprendere i principali ecosistemi relazionali
  • Leggere execution plan a livello base
  • Prepararsi ai percorsi SQL Server, MySQL o Oracle
2

Step 2

� Livello 2 — Amministrazione, affidabilità e performance

PREMIUMIntermediate

Vai oltre le query. Impara strategia indici, permessi, backup, monitoraggio, recovery, ruoli e troubleshooting performance. Qui la conoscenza database diventa operativa e spendibile nel lavoro reale.

Recommended certification

Oracle Database SQL

Recommended certification

Ottimizzazione query

Recommended certification

Backup & recovery

Recommended certification

Ruoli e permessi

Obiettivo: Gestire database veloci, sicuri, recuperabili e pronti per ambienti reali.

Reality check

Le aziende non cercano solo persone che sappiano interrogare dati. Cercano persone che capiscano cosa succede quando un database rallenta, si rompe o diventa instabile.

Common mistakes

  • Ignorare i backup finché qualcosa non si rompe
  • Aggiungere indici a caso
  • Usare privilegi admin senza logica di sicurezza
  • Pensare che le performance siano un argomento avanzato da rimandare

What you can realistically achieve

  • Comprendere affidabilità e recovery database
  • Riconoscere problemi comuni di performance
  • Avvicinarsi a percorsi DBA, backend e data engineering
3

Step 3

� Livello 3 — NoSQL e mentalità moderna

PREMIUMIntermediate

Quando il relazionale è chiaro, aggiungi NoSQL. MongoDB è utile per schemi flessibili, modelli documentali e applicazioni moderne, ma non sostituisce le basi SQL.

Recommended certification

MongoDB Developer

Obiettivo: Capire quando NoSQL ha senso e modellare documenti correttamente.

Reality check

NoSQL è potente ma spesso frainteso. L’obiettivo non è evitare struttura, ma scegliere il modello dati corretto per il problema corretto.

Common mistakes

  • Usare MongoDB solo perché sembra più semplice
  • Creare documenti senza logica strutturale
  • Ignorare consistenza e query pattern
  • Pensare che NoSQL sostituisca sempre SQL

What you can realistically achieve

  • Comprendere quando MongoDB è adatto
  • Modellare dati documentali più chiaramente
  • Combinare mentalità SQL e NoSQL nelle app moderne

💰 Salary outlook Database (2026)

I range salariali globali cambiano in base a paese, azienda e specializzazione. Usali come orientamento, non come promessa.

Junior

$45k–$70k

Mid-level

$75k–$110k

Senior / DBA

$120k+

La crescita più veloce arriva spesso dalla combinazione di SQL, performance, affidabilità database e progetti reali.

🔍 SQL vs NoSQL — da cosa partire?

La maggior parte delle persone dovrebbe partire da SQL. NoSQL ha molto più senso dopo aver capito bene il relazionale.

SQL / RelazionaleNoSQL / MongoDB
Ideale perDati strutturati, reporting, consistenzaModelli flessibili, iterazione veloce
Uso tipicoBusiness app, sistemi enterpriseApp moderne, sistemi documentali
Partire da qui?Sì, per quasi tuttiDopo le basi SQL

Consiglio

Parti da SQL. Costruisci sicurezza con MySQL o SQL Server e aggiungi MongoDB solo più avanti.

FAQ

Quale database dovrei studiare per primo?

Parti dai fondamenti SQL. MySQL è di solito il punto di ingresso più semplice e pratico.

Mi serve Oracle?

Solo se punti a contesti enterprise dove Oracle è molto diffuso. È utile, ma non obbligatorio per tutti.

MongoDB basta per trovare lavoro?

Aiuta, ma SQL resta ancora la base più universale richiesta dalle aziende.

Come divento spendibile più velocemente?

Crea un mini progetto reale: schema, query, indici, backup e ragionamento sulle performance.

🚀 Parti ora (percorso pratico)

Impara prima SQL. Allenati ogni giorno. Poi rafforza il relazionale e aggiungi MongoDB solo quando le basi diventano naturali.